Background

NAMPT serves as the catalyst for the condensation reaction between nicotinamide and 5-phosphoribosyl-1-pyrophosphate, giving rise to nicotinamide mononucleotide—a pivotal intermediate in the biosynthesis of NAD. As the rate-limiting factor in the mammalian NAD biosynthetic pathway, NAMPT holds a central role in cellular processes. Beyond its enzymatic function, the secreted form of NAMPT exhibits dual properties, acting as both a cytokine with immunomodulating effects and an adipokine with anti-diabetic attributes. Notably, its extracellular function lacks enzymatic activity, partially due to the absence of activation by ATP, which is present at low levels in the extracellular space and plasma. Moreover, NAMPT plays a crucial role in the modulation of circadian clock function, orchestrating the oscillatory production of NAD to regulate clock target gene expression by facilitating the release of the CLOCK-BMAL1 heterodimer from NAD-dependent SIRT1-mediated suppression.

  • Do most proteins show cross-species activity?

    Species cross-reactivity must be investigated individually for each product. Many human cytokines will produce a nice response in mouse cell lines, and many mouse proteins will show activity on human cells. Other proteins may have a lower specific activity when used in the opposite species.
